Description

Exceptional Antique Sterling Silver Pill Box
Continental * Circa 1900s
This little silver pill box is of
exceptional quality. The top has a hand engraved vase spilling over
with flowers and scrolling leaves. The top slides back and the interior
is all gilded. There is a round hole in the corner to dispense a small
pill, or larger pills can be accessed by sliding the top further back.
It is marked “925” for sterling silver and it has a tiny ship’s wheel
maker’s mark.
The condition
is excellent with no dents or other damage and it closes very securely when the top slides closed. It
measures slightly over 1 3/4″ x 1 3/8″ and is incredibly heavy for its size, 35.9 grams.
